What is the Mrbeastxbet Scam?

The Mrbeastxbet.com scam is a fraudulent cryptocurrency gambling site that pretends to be a legitimate online casino. It offers familiar-looking games like Plinko, Dice, and Slots, combined with large bonuses and fake user activity to appear trustworthy. Its true goal is to steal crypto and personal data from unsuspecting users.

The Mrbeastxbet scam operates through a well-designed funnel of deceit. First, it attracts users with flashy promotions – bonuses ranging from $2,000 to $10,000, no deposit required. Once users sign up, they are given fake bonus credits and experience early wins, creating trust and excitement. This sets the trap. As users attempt to withdraw fake winnings, the site demands personal identification through bogus KYC procedures. These documents are never used for verification but are harvested for identity theft. Then come the withdrawal obstacles – users are told they must deposit funds to โ€œverifyโ€ accounts or pay โ€œtaxes.โ€ Each payment only leads to more excuses and more demands. Fake customer service representatives continue stringing the victim along, using social engineering and urgency tactics. When victims resist or stop paying, theyโ€™re ignored or blocked. Eventually, Mrbeastxbet disappears and reemerges under a different domain, repeating the scam with a new batch of victims.

Mrbeastxbet Damage Control
If youโ€™ve interacted with Mrbeastxbet, your priority is to secure your digital assets. Freeze your crypto wallets and banking accounts immediately. Change passwords for all accounts used during your interaction with Mrbeastxbet. Identity documents shared for โ€œKYCโ€ should be considered compromised – monitor for misuse. Accept that crypto already lost may be unrecoverable; many victims lose more by chasing recovery scams. Focus instead on securing what remains. Explore professional recovery services only after protecting yourself and verifying their legitimacy. Avoid acting out of desperation, and resist communication from any unverified third parties claiming they can โ€œhelpโ€ recover your funds.

Tips for Damage Control :

  • Disconnect any wallet linked to Mrbeastxbet immediately. Revoke permissions via wallet settings and blockchain explorers.
  • Change all passwords – especially those related to exchanges, wallets, and email accounts used during the scam.
  • Monitor identity theft signs if you submitted ID. Consider freezing your credit and signing up for ID monitoring services.
  • Report the scam to official platforms. Notify your crypto exchange, law enforcement, and platforms like the FTC or local cybercrime units.
  • Avoid recovery scam offers. Many new scams target victims of the original scam with false promises.
  • Secure two-factor authentication (2FA) on all crypto and email accounts to prevent further compromise.

These measures wonโ€™t reverse losses but will protect you from further harm and reduce your digital risk exposure going forward.


What Are the Usual Mrbeastxbet Red Flags?

Crypto casino scams like Mrbeastxbet share many red flags. These platforms often rely on high-volume, low-effort tactics, banking on users acting emotionally rather than rationally. Attention to detail and critical thinking are your best protection. By knowing what to look for, users can spot and avoid platforms like Mrbeastxbet early – before any losses occur.

The promise of massive bonuses just for signing up – sometimes up to $10,000 – is a major red flag. No real casino gives away large sums without strict conditions or verification, especially with no deposit required.

Mrbeastxbet often includes fake pop-ups showing user activity, wins, and โ€œVIPโ€ bonuses. These fake stats are designed to simulate legitimacy but collapse under scrutiny – names repeat, amounts are unrealistic, and timing is too consistent.

Withdrawal hurdles are a classic scam signal. If a platform requires deposits to โ€œunlockโ€ funds, โ€œverifyโ€ identity, or pay โ€œtaxes,โ€ itโ€™s almost certainly a scam like Mrbeastxbet.

Impersonated celebrity endorsements are another warning sign. Mrbeastxbet frequently uses names and images of public figures such as Elon Musk or social media influencers to create trust through false authority.

Lack of transparency is always suspect. Mrbeastxbet provides no valid licenses, no corporate address, and only fake customer support. Legitimate platforms always display clear licensing and contact details.

Tips to Stay Protected From Casino Crypto Scams Like Mrbeastxbet

Avoiding scams like Mrbeastxbet is far easier than recovering from one. Crypto-based gambling scams exploit emotional triggers and fast-paced interfaces to trick users. Recognizing the signs and applying basic digital hygiene can prevent most attacks. Review the red flags above carefully. By staying calm and informed, users can avoid becoming targets of this common trap.

  • Always check the domain age. Use WHOIS tools to verify when the site was registered. Mrbeastxbet-type scams are almost always less than a year old.
  • Ignore offers that sound too good to be true. No real casino gives away $10,000 for free. Bonuses from Mrbeastxbet are bait, not gifts.
  • Never deposit to withdraw. A real platform never requires you to โ€œverifyโ€ with money. This is a defining tactic of Mrbeastxbet-type frauds.
  • Research before signing up. Search for third-party reviews. If the only reviews are on the site itself, or if they all seem overly positive, itโ€™s likely part of the scam.
  • Demand regulatory proof. Legitimate casinos list their licensing and regulatory info. Mrbeastxbet only shows vague claims with no verifiable data.
  • Watch for fake urgency. Phrases like โ€œlimited-time offerโ€ or โ€œVIP bonuses ending soonโ€ are often psychological ploys to push impulsive actions.
  • Avoid crypto-only casinos without reputation. Crypto is irreversible. Without a trusted name or legal backing, you’re gambling more than your money – you’re risking your identity too.

By combining awareness with deliberate online behavior, you can stay safe from scams like Mrbeastxbet. A cautious user is a scammerโ€™s worst enemy.
